How can I reduce maintenance while supporting local ecology?

Transitioning high-maintenance turf to native plantings like Purple Coneflower, Butterfly Milkweed, and Little Bluestem reduces mowing frequency from weekly to seasonal. These species establish deep root systems that improve soil structure while providing habitat for pollinators. Can I maintain healthy turf while following water conservation guidelines?

Wi-Fi ET-based weather sensing irrigation automatically adjusts schedules using real-time evapotranspiration data. This technology preserves Kentucky Bluegrass and Tall Fescue blends while reducing water application by 25-40% compared to traditional timers.
